Clarence W. Kearney, CPA
Partner
Clarence W. Kearney is a partner with Malin Bergquist, Erie’s fastest-growing accounting firm, with offices also in Pittsburgh and Greensburg.
He has practiced as a CPA in Erie for more than four decades, and was a founding partner of Diefenbach Delio Kearney & DeDionisio which merged in mid-2007 with Malin Bergquist.
Clarence serves as a tax and business consultant to more than 100 businesses and 350 individuals in Northwest Pennsylvania. He has deep knowledge of manufacturing, wholesale and retail distribution, hotels and restaurants, professional services businesses including insurance, law, health care facilities and physicians and dentists.
During the past 40 years, Clarence has advised and assisted clients on mergers and acquisitions, recapitalizations and reorganizations. He has prepared valuations of businesses for acquisitions, disposals and gift tax purposes. He has worked with clients and the Internal Revenue Service on tax matters extensively.
He also has served as an expert witness regarding divorce matters, lost income and valuation matters.
Clarence is a graduate of Gannon University and is a member of the American and Pennsylvania Institute of CPAs. He is Past President of The Erie Chapter of CPAs and the Sertoma Club of Erie. He currently is the Chairman of the Hamot Second Century Foundation and is the past Chairman of the Hamot Audit & Investment Committee and recently finished twelve years of service on the Hamot Health Foundation and Hamot Medical Center Boards.
Clarence is a Corporator at Corry Memorial Hospital in Corry, PA and a past member of the Board of Governors of The Kahkwa Club, where he served as its Treasurer for eight years. He has authored an article on tax planning in the Business Magazine of Erie's Manufacturer and Business Association and has been featured in a Hamot Health Foundation article headlined "On the Road to Philanthropy."
He is also a board member of Emergycare Ambulance Service and Life Star Helicopter in the Erie, PA area, and is a board director and treasurer of the “Roar on the Shore”, one of Erie's largest citywide events which has raised tens of thousands of dollars for hospitals and for military veterans and their families. He is an avid golfer and rider of Harley Davidson Motorcycles and has been profiled in the "Member Spotlight" of the Pennsylvania CPA Journal about his love of biking.
He has been married to Sandra G. Kearney, CPA for over 40 years.
